Challenge: Free the ELF

... and make your way to the final end.

das hackit bzw. die challenge besteht im prinzip aus drei teilen (je nach betrachtungsweise könnte man aber auch sagen es sind 2 oder 4 teile).
wenn ihr die challenge gelöst habt, erhaltet ihr am ende ein lösungswort. dieses dann bitte per pn an mich schicken.
viel spass! ;)


List of Fame:
1. bond
2. treo
3. lagalopex
 
hmm ... und wie kommt man da ran? mit was beginnt man am besten? mit welchem programm? hex editor?
lg
 
und wie kommt man da ran? mit was beginnt man am besten? mit welchem programm? hex editor?
Hexeditor ist empfehlenswert, genauso wie nachher etwas googlen. Wenn ich jetzt sagen würde, woran ich scheitere, wäre das ein direkter Hinweis auf die Lösung ;)
 
ja wenn man sich das jpg im hexeditor anschaut fallt eh sofort was ins auge. aber ich weiß nicht wirklich was ich damit anfangen soll. also so ein kleines howto wär schon was interessantes.
lg
 
Original von ERit
ja wenn man sich das jpg im hexeditor anschaut fallt eh sofort was ins auge. aber ich weiß nicht wirklich was ich damit anfangen soll. also so ein kleines howto wär schon was interessantes.
lg
ok mal n kleiner tip. es handelt sich dabei um eine verbreitete kodierung um binärdaten in einen zusammenhängenden ascii string umzuwandeln. typisches kennzeichen dieser kodierung sind die ein oder zwei "=" am ende des strings (nicht immer). ;)

der erste hat das hackit übrigens gelöst.
 
crypto tool? base 64? kA, na egal =) hab grad viel zu tun für die schule. aber die grundbegriffe sind klar. dachte zuerst dass man die gitterstäbe aus dem jpeg entfernen sollte. aber ich denke mal dass das kaum möglich sein wird, außer man findet einen weg dafür. jedenfalls habe ich eine lösung gefunden, wie man strings in jpeg´s versteckt =) (war immer schon ein ungeklärtes phenomän für mich) =)
lg
 
ok, habs :D
war aber eigentlich einfach, das schwere wars meinen gcc zu aktuallisieren ;)

Würde mich über mehr solche Linux sachen freuen :D
 
k numero zwei hats gelöst.

ich vermute mal allzuviel wird hier nicht mehr passieren, von daher würde ich vorschlagen, dass ihr beide mal eure lösungswege beschreibt. damit die anderen auch n bissl was lernen können.
 
Das das ELF-Binary base64-codiert im JPEG-Kommentar steht, war ja jetzt klar ;)

Im Gegensatz zu treo hab ich die Aufgabe, wie bond auch gelöst.

nehmen wir ein feld von 1x3, wieviele rechtecke passen rein:
3*1x1
2*1x2
1*1x3
Die Überlegung fortgesetzt und auf die zweite dimension ausgeweitet, kommt man auf:
(1+2+3+4+5+...+X)^2
Was ja nichts weiter als das Quadrat der arithmetischen Reihe ist.
also:
=(X*(X+1))^2 / 4

Womit auch der Fehler in bond's Formel geklärt wäre ;)

Achja... das Lösungswort ist ein typischer Spruch über Elfen :D
 
Ich weiß ich komm ein paar Jahre zu spät für den thread =)

Wollte mich trotzdem für das crackMe und die tutorials bedanken.
 
Zurück
Oben